    Honoring a Local Hero: New SVCC Scholarship Fund Established in Memory of Nottoway’s Antonyo Henderson, Sr.

    2024-05-16
    https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=3Hdjmu_0t3zxY7u00

    The Antonyo 'Tonyo' Henderson, Sr. #12 Legacy Scholarship Fund has been created to honor Antonyo Henderson, Sr., a respected individual from Nottoway County. This scholarship supports students from Nottoway and Brunswick Counties who are pursuing higher education at Southside Virginia Community College (SVCC). It offers financial help for tuition and books, easing the financial challenges of college education.

    Antonyo Henderson, also known as 'Tonyo,' was a standout athlete at Nottoway County High School. As a quarterback, he led the varsity Cougars to an undefeated season in 1998, culminating in a state championship. His performance and leadership contributed significantly to his team's success.

    Following his high school achievements, Henderson attended Southside Virginia Community College, the same institution that benefits from the scholarship fund. His legacy continues to influence and support the community, especially young people seeking higher education.
